Head Boys Basketball Coach Vacancy:
PURPOSE Coordinate and provide overall leadership of their respective athletic programs.
ORGANIZATIONAL RELATIONSHIP
Reports to the Athletic Director and is evaluated by the Athletic Director. Supervises all assistant coaches and feeder programs Works with the Assistant Athletic Director for scheduling of facilities/games.
APPOINTMENT 26-27
School Year Compensated appropriately on the stipend salary schedule.
RESPONSIBILITIES
Promotes the vision/mission of Saint Viator High School and Saint Viator Athletics Assures that a coherent, comprehensive district program is established and maintained Assists the Assistant Athletic Director with building the season schedule Develops a consistent philosophy for discipline Affords opportunity for off-season options such as summer camps/off-season practices. Assists in field/mat/gym maintenance with his/her team when necessary Extends considerable time and effort with the press for team/athlete/school recognition Maintains inter-level communication with assistant coaches. Maintains harmonious relationships with conference coaches Will be involved in practice/games 6 days a week during the season, unless special circumstances prevail, withstanding holidays Maintains IHSA expectations and compliance Supports lower-level games when possible Works with the Athletic Director in establishing an accountable budget Remains current on practices and procedures relative to coaching expertise Evaluates assistant coaches Maintains a positive attitude with staff and players at all times. Actively supports the athletic handbook Attends all head coaches' meetings Attends all necessary Conference and IHSA meetings Maintains open communication with parents and students Encourages participation in other sports, does not prohibit or discourage this participation Observes and illustrates good sportsmanship at all times Attends all lower-level awards ceremonies Ensures there is an end-of-year banquet for their team(s) Keeps an updated inventory of all uniforms, equipment, and supplies Other duties as assigned by the Athletic Director
